We hope that there will be a certain process accelerating the Karabakh talks at the OSCE Summit in Astana, Polish Ambassador to Armenia Zdzislaw Raczynsky told the journalists today.

According to him, nothing crucial will happen, as resolution of a conflict is a long process demanding much time.

Armenian President Serzh Sargsyan will also attend the summit scheduled for December 1-2.

As NEWS.am reported earlier, summit participants will discuss protracted conflicts, including situation in the Caucasus. The summit will bring together presidents and heads of governments of 56 member states, 12 OSCE partner countries, as well as heads of 68 international organizations.
